A Visit To The Century Old Auckland Museum

The Auckland Museum, which has been at the city center for almost a century, is one of New Zealand's most notable structures and offers insight into the culture and history of the country. As soon as you enter the space, your experience at the museum is immediately enhanced by the exquisite neo-classical design and architecture. Along with natural history specimens and exhibitions on New Zealand's history and culture, the museum also has a notable collection of Maori and Pacific artifacts. You can also pay your respects to fallen heroes at the War Memorial Gallery, which is a touching memorial to those who have served New Zealand in times of war.

Deep Dive Into New Zealand's History and Culture with the Gallery Highlights Tour

The 1-hour Gallery Highlights guided tour, led by a professional guide, will take you through the museum's important galleries, providing a thorough understanding of New Zealand's past and present. This is an excellent opportunity to learn about lesser-known aspects of Maori and Pacific culture. At the Natural History Gallery, you may also learn about the country's geological history and view some of the numerous fossils discovered there.

Discover The Architectural Secrets Of Auckland Museum with the Hidden Heritage Tour

The 1-hour Hidden Heritage Tour gives you a peek into the museum's architectural past. This is your chance to learn about the museum's architects, the stories concealed within its wall cavities, and its history over time. You'll also get to see some of the museum's lesser-known facets, such as early plans and pictures.
